大数据赋能:实时数据处理的机器学习工程实践与优化
|
大数据时代,数据量的爆炸式增长对传统数据处理方式提出了严峻挑战。实时数据处理成为关键需求,而机器学习在其中扮演了重要角色。通过将机器学习算法与大数据技术结合,可以实现对海量数据的高效分析和决策支持。 实时数据处理的核心在于低延迟和高吞吐量。传统的批处理方式难以满足这一需求,因此流式计算框架如Apache Kafka、Apache Flink等被广泛应用。这些工具能够持续接收和处理数据流,为机器学习模型提供实时输入。
AI图片,仅供参考 机器学习工程实践需要考虑数据预处理、特征工程和模型训练等多个环节。在实时场景中,数据可能具有动态变化的特性,这要求模型具备良好的适应性和稳定性。为此,工程师通常采用在线学习或增量学习方法,使模型能够持续更新并保持准确性。优化是提升系统性能的关键。从硬件层面来看,使用高性能计算资源和分布式架构可以显著提高处理速度。软件层面则需关注算法效率和代码优化,例如通过模型压缩和量化降低计算开销。 数据质量直接影响模型效果。在实时处理中,需要建立有效的数据清洗和验证机制,确保输入数据的准确性和一致性。同时,监控系统运行状态和模型表现,有助于及时发现和解决问题。 随着技术不断进步,大数据赋能下的机器学习工程正在向更智能、更高效的方向发展。未来,随着边缘计算和5G等新技术的普及,实时数据处理与机器学习的融合将更加紧密,推动各行各业的数字化转型。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

